Lifepo4 batteries, or lithium iron phosphate batteries, are a type of lithium-ion battery that utilizes iron phosphate as the cathode material. This composition offers several advantages, including enhanced safety, longer lifespan, and improved thermal stability. Unlike conventional lithium-ion batteries, lifepo4 batteries are less prone to overheating and thermal runaway, making them a safer option for energy storage.
